> > Now, the bad news:
> >
> > The thing is, however, that development on the first version of illume (which is
> > probably what you are using right now) has almost stopped, since the focus has
> > shifted to illume2, the new one. While the first version is still in the source
> > tree and provided by the binary packages, it's going to be unsupported and
> > removed at some point.
>
> So it has still been worked on until recently? I thought I read
> about the development stop already a year ago...
Well... The previous upstream snapshot was from december 2009, at which point
illume2 wasn't 100% done. Even though development on illume1 had almost stopped,
it was still the best choice.
